NOTE 12—COMMITMENTS AND CONTINGENCIES

 

Management Control Acquisition Agreement — On June 12, 2017, the Company entered into a Management Control Acquisition Agreement (the “MCAA”) with Telcon Holdings, Inc. (“Telcon Holdings”), a Korean corporation, and Telcon RF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(formerly Telcon Inc.), (“Telcon”), a Korean-based public company whose shares are listed on KOSDAQ, a trading board of Korea Exchange in South Korea. In accordance with the MCAA, the Company invested approximately $31.8 million to purchase 6,643,559 shares of Telcon common stock at a purchase price of approximately $4.79 per share. 

The MCAA was amended in certain respect and supplemented by an Agreement, dated as of September 29, 2017, among the parties. Pursuant to the September 2017 Agreement, among other things, Telcon purchased 4,444,445 shares of Company common stock from KPM Tech Co., Ltd and Hanil Vacuum Co., Ltd. at a price of $6.60 per share.

 

On July 2, 2018, the Company entered into an Additional Agreement with Evercore Investment Holdings Co., Ltd. (formerly Telcon Holdings Co., Ltd.), (“Evercore”), and Telcon. In the Additional Agreement, the Company agreed to use the proceeds from the sales of its KPM shares to repurchase shares of Company common stock from Telcon at a price of $7.60 a share, subject to certain exceptions, and Telcon granted the Company the right to purchase from Telcon all or a portion of its shares of the Company at a price of $7.60 a share until October 31, 2018 and at a price to be agreed upon after October 31, 2018. The Company repurchased 495,000 shares of the Company common stock from Telcon at a price of $7.60 a share in 2018.

 

API Supply Agreement — On June 12, 2017, the Company entered into an API Supply Agreement (the “API Agreement”) with Telcon pursuant to which Telcon paid the Company approximately $31.8 million in consideration of the right to supply 25% of the Company’s requirements for bulk containers of PGLG for a fifteen-year term. The amount was recorded as deferred trade discount. On July 12, 2017, the Company entered into a raw material supply agreement with Telcon which revised certain terms of the API supply agreement (the “revised API agreement”). The revised API agreement is effective for a term of five years and will renew automatically for 10 successive one-year renewal periods, except as either party may determine. In the revised API agreement, the Company has agreed to purchase a total of 940,000 kilograms of PGLG at $50 USD per kilogram, or a total of $47.0 million, over the term of the agreement. In September 2018, the Company entered into an agreement with Ajinomoto and Telcon to facilitate Telcon’s purchase of PGLG from Ajinomoto for resale to the Company under the revised API agreement.

 

On June 16, 2019, the Company entered into an agreement with Telcon to adjust the price payable to Telcon under the revised API agreement from $50 per kilogram of PGLG to $100 per kilogram from July 1, 2019 through June 30, 2020, with the price payable after June 30, 2020 to be subject to agreement between the parties. The PGLG raw material purchased from Telcon is recorded in inventory at net realizable value and the excess purchase price is recorded against deferred trade discount.
